JOB POSTING
DALHOUSIE UNIVERSITY  Halifax, Nova Scotia, Canada
Department of Mathematics and Statistics
POSTING DATE: May 13, 2013  
 
10 month Limited Term Instructor
August 1, 2013- May 31, 2014
 
Pay Rate:  In accordance with DFA pay scale
DUTIES:
The instructor is to teach three courses in the fall term, and three courses in the winter term at the first and second year levels.  The courses will be two sections each of Math 1000 (Fall term) and two sections of Math 1010 (Winter term), as well as one additional course each term from among the undergraduate Mathematics curriculum.
The instructor is responsible for all aspects of teaching, grading and administration of the classes and in addition is to be available for three hours per week outside class times for student consultation.  The instructor will also serve as coordinator for Math 1000 and Math 1010, which involves collaboration and consultation with the Director of the Math and Stats Resource Centre.
 
The instructor reports to the Chair.
QUALIFICATIONS:  The candidate must possess a PhD in an appropriate discipline, and have experience teaching and coordinating large multi-section mathematics classes, as well as experience with WebCT.

JOB POSTING
DALHOUSIE UNIVERSITY Halifax, Nova Scotia, Canada
Department of Mathematics and Statistics
POSTING DATE: May 13, 2013
 
10 month Limited Term Instructor

August 1,2013 – May 31, 2014
 
 Pay Rate:      In accordance to the DFA pay scale

DUTIES:
The duties consist of teaching Stat 1060 (two modules each term plus coordination), Stat 2080 (fall), Stat 2060 (winter), Stat 3350 (winter).

The topics to be covered in the courses are available from the Chair of the Department.  Descriptions are also given in the Undergraduate Calendar for 2013 – 2014, published by the Registrar's Office, Dalhousie University.
 
The instructor reports to the Chair.

QUALIFICATIONS:  The candidate must possess a PhD and have experience teaching and coordinating large multi-section statistics classes.  Experience with the Minitab, SAS and R/Splus computer languages is essential, as is previous experience with WebCT.
